Originally Posted by Monster3663
Boost what to 19? MPG?
Lol no, Turbo boost, it should be around 9 or 10 PSI stock, those engines are built very well, and can take a few more pounds on stock internals safely. All it is, is changing the limits of the stock ECU, some companies even make it where you can run multiple programs for example, your 97 octane tune, itll be the most powerfull other than race fuel or e85, then you can have stock, or like vallet where the car wont go over a set speed. This would've been my next step if I still had my jetta, of course I went wouldve went with some more aggresive tunes which require back up mods like a bigger intercoller and such.
